孔雀鱼(Guppy)是一种常见的观赏鱼,它们属于胎生鱼类,母鱼在孕期和产后期可能会出现吃小鱼的行为。这一现象可以从以下几个角度来解释:
-
本能行为:孔雀鱼母鱼吃小鱼首先是一种本能行为。在野外环境中,刚生产的母鱼为了保护自己的后代,避免天敌的威胁,可能会吃掉体质虚弱或受伤的小鱼,以确保种群中只有最强壮的个体存活下来。
-
营养需求:产后的母鱼需要大量的营养来恢复体力,如果在产前和产后没有得到足够的食物补充,它们可能会将小鱼视为食物来源,这种情况下吃小鱼是为了满足自身的营养需求。
-
环境因素:
- 水族箱空间:如果水族箱空间有限,母鱼可能会感到压力和领地威胁,吃小鱼可以减少竞争资源(如食物和空间)的个体数量。
- 水族箱布局:缺乏足够的躲避空间,小鱼容易成为母鱼的捕食目标。
-
社会阶层:在鱼群中,社会阶层分明。有时母鱼会通过吃小鱼来确立或维护自己在鱼群中的地位。
-
人为因素:
- 饲料问题:如果喂食不当,如饲料不够营养或种类单一,母鱼可能会寻找其他蛋白质来源,包括小鱼。
- 水质问题:水质不佳可能会导致鱼类行为异常,包括攻击性增强。
如何避免孔雀鱼母鱼吃小鱼?
-
提供充足的营养:确保母鱼在孕期和产后期获得丰富多样的食物,以满足其营养需求。
-
改善水质:保持良好的水质,定期更换部分水体,减少水质问题导致的行为异常。
-
增加躲避空间:在水族箱中设置足够的植物和装饰物,为小鱼提供躲避空间。
-
及时隔离:观察母鱼的行为,如果发现其对小鱼表现出攻击性,应及时将小鱼隔离饲养。
-
合理规划鱼群结构:避免在水族箱中饲养过多的小鱼,保持合理的鱼群结构和数量。
-
咨询专家:在遇到问题时,可以咨询宠物店的专家或资深养鱼爱好者,获取更专业的建议。
以上就是关于孔雀鱼母鱼为什么会吃小鱼以及如何避免这一行为的专业解答。希望对您有所帮助。